Cement repair services involve restoring and strengthening concrete surfaces that have experienced damage or deterioration over time. This process typically includes patching cracks, filling voids, and addressing surface imperfections to improve the structural integrity and appearance of the concrete. Skilled service providers use specialized materials and techniques to ensure that repairs blend seamlessly with existing surfaces, helping to extend the lifespan of the concrete and prevent further damage.
These services are essential for resolving common problems such as cracking, spalling, and surface scaling, which can compromise the safety and functionality of concrete structures. Cracks may develop due to ground movement, temperature fluctuations, or heavy loads, while spalling and scaling often result from freeze-thaw cycles or improper installation.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, reduce the risk of accidents, and maintain the property’s value.

Repair Costs - The cost for cement repair services typ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and size of the area. For example, small cracks may cost around $300, while larger sections needing extensive work could reach $1,200 or more.
Material Expenses - Material costs for cement repair can vary from $50 to $200 per bag of repair mix or concrete, depending on quality and quantity needed. Larger projects require more materials, which can influence overall expenses significantly.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for cement repair services generally range between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on project complexity and the number of workers involved.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include surface preparation, sealing, or finishing, which can add $100 to $500 to the total cost. These costs vary based on the specific repair requirements and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es cracks in concrete slabs? Cracks can result from soil settling, temperature changes, or heavy loads that stress the concrete over time.
How can I tell if my concrete need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ven surfaces, or areas of spalling that indicate potential structural issues.
What types of cement repair services are available? Services typically include crack filling, surface patching, and slab leveling to restore stability and appearance.
How long does cement rep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age but often ranges from a few hours to a few days.
